Software Engineer
16 hours ago
2 years exp
**Roles & Responsibilities**
To ensure success as a Software Engineer, you should have strong managerial skills, extensive experience with Microsoft Frameworks, and advanced problem-solving skills. A top-class. NET Software Engineer ensures the software development team produces scalable, high-quality and functional systems. Ultimately, you’ll use your expertise in the.NET framework to help us develop and deploy high-quality systems based on micro services and cloud-native.
.NET Software Engineer responsibilities include participating in the entire software development life cycle, definition, creation and configuration of the systems. You will be part of a distributed team around the world working with tools that enable you to work in a high quality environment.
You will be part of a team with members all around the world all working to get the best out of the systems to fit business in all regions. Our business is the smart metering but we are moving to IoT and Data Analytic. You will be working at the edge of the technology and supported by a strong positioned company like EDMI.
**Responsibilities**:
- Write clean, testable code using.NET core programming languages
- Develop technical specifications and architecture
- Review and refactor code
- Analyse system requirements and prioritize tasks
- Document development and operational procedures
- Deploy fully functional system
- Upgrade existing programs
**Requirements**:
- Bachelor’s degree in Computer Science/Engineering, Electrical Engineering or Information Technology.
- Previous experience as a.NET developer, at least 5 years.
- In-depth knowledge of.NET languages like C#,.Netcore, OO. C++ is desirable.
- Knowledge with front-end development languages including Angular 2, JavaScript, HTML5, and CSS.
- Familiarity with agile environments
- Good communication skills in English
- Desirable to have experience in developing system based in micro services
- Desirable to have experience with cloud technologies
- Desirable to have knowledge of Big Data tools like Kafka, Hadoop, HBase, time-series databases
- Desirable to have experience in container deployment such as Dockers or Kubernetes
EDMI is one of the leading Smart Energy Solutions providers in the world. We are dedicated to the design, development and manufacturing of innovative and technologically advanced energy meters and metering systems for the global utility industry.
**Vision**:Global Energy Solution Leader
**Mission**:Challenge for advanced technologies, create new values and be responsible for better society through our energy solutions.
-
Test Software Development Engineer
16 hours ago
Yishun, Singapore EDMI LIMITED Full time2 years exp **Roles & Responsibilities** - Design, development and implementation of production testing in house or outsource. - Develop new test setup, procedures, tools to automate test activities or liaise with vendors. - Identify/develop new SW test methods to improve test cycle time - Review the test Software, verify and maintain the document. Test...
-
Software Engineer
2 weeks ago
Yishun New Town, Singapore ASMPT Singapore Pte Ltd Full time $90,000 - $120,000 per yearJob Description:We are seeking a Software Engineer to develop and optimize software solutions for advanced packaging semiconductor equipment. This role involves designing, implementing, and testing high-performance software to enhance automation, control, and data processing for semiconductor manufacturing. You will collaborate with cross-functional teams to...
-
Software Engineer
2 weeks ago
Yishun, Singapore Broadcom Full timePlease Note: **Job Description**: **Responsibilities**: - Solve end-to-end problems independently by writing requirements, designing, and implementing software - Research and implement new technologies to enhance the efficacy of Symantec's Security Products - Unit testing, code refactoring and system optimizing for a better performance in a world class...
-
Software Engineer
2 weeks ago
Yishun New Town, Singapore STAFFKING PTE LTD Full time $90,000 - $120,000 per yearSummary:5 Days, 8am-5:30pmLocation: Yishun Industrial ParkIndustry: Semiconductors & Electronics manufacturer in SingaporeMNC, great company prospectsAWS & Bonus givenResponsibilities:Design, develop, and maintain software for semiconductor equipment, including motion control, data acquisition, and process automationCollaborate with hardware and mechanical...
-
Software Analyst
16 hours ago
Yishun, Singapore EDMI LIMITED Full time2 years exp **Roles & Responsibilities** **Job Brief** The Software Analyst will be responsible for the gathering requirement and produce acceptance criteria based on stakeholder and partner’s input. You will be part of a team with members all around the world all working to get the best out of the systems to fit business in all regions. Our business is...
-
Embedded Software Engineer
4 days ago
Yishun New Town, Singapore ASMPT Singapore Pte Ltd Full time $60,000 - $120,000 per yearAbout the role ASMPT Singapore Pte Ltd. is seeking an experienced Embedded Software Engineer to join our team in the Yishun North Region. This is a full-time position where you will be responsible for developing and implementing high-quality embedded software solutions that are critical to the success of our innovative engineering projects.What you'll be...
-
Software Quality Engineer
1 week ago
Yishun New Town, Singapore WSH Experts Pte Ltd Full time $60,000 - $100,000 per yearJob Description & RequirementsResponsibilitiesDesign and implement comprehensive test plans, test cases, test data and test scripts to ensure the quality of software products.Collaborate with Product Owners and stakeholders to define test objectives, scope and entry/exit criteria for testing phases.Perform system testing (e.g., functional and performance...
-
Solution Test Engineer
16 hours ago
Yishun, Singapore EDMI LIMITED Full time1 year exp **Roles & Responsibilities** - Create and execute test cases and procedures as assigned. - Document and monitor testing outcomes and establish steps to remedy problems, working with product/solution management, project management and multiple development teams across the organisation to provide feedback and ensure product/solution success. -...
-
Test Development Engineer, Principal
5 days ago
Yishun, Singapore Broadcom Full timePlease Note: **Job Description**: We are looking for an experienced Test Development Engineer. - Be part of a worldwide R&D group, supporting the development of advanced fiber optic testing systems. - Actively collaborate to the design of Software and Hardware for extremely high data rate and complex modulation test solutions. - Work hands on with software...
-
IT & System Engineer #56944
16 hours ago
Yishun, Singapore Anradus Pte Ltd Full timeIndustry/ Organization Type: Manufacturing - Computer, electronic - Position Title**:IT & System Engineer/ IT Engineer**: - Working Location: Yishun - Working Hours: 5 days, Mon - Fri (8.30 am - 6.00 pm) - Salary Package**:Up to $4000 + $160 (Fixed Allowance) + AWS**: - Duration: Permanent Role **Key Responsibilities** - Analyse business requirements and...